Box 610368, Port Huron, MI 48061, 866-295-4143, fbns@wayoflife.org; for instructions about subscribing and unsubscribing or changing addresses, see the information paragraph at the end of the article) We receive many requests from people seeking our help in finding a good church for themselves or for their friends and relatives, so in early 1998 I decided to build a directory of fundamental Baptist churches at the Way of Life web site. Though it has not been easy to decide which churches to list and how to rate them (a problem we have resolved only very imperfectly), the Lord has richly blessed this effort. In 1999, our friend Larry Walther, a member of the Fundamental Baptist Church in Escondido, California, graciously took on the job of maintaining the directory for me. In late 2004, the job of overseeing the directory was assumed by our friend and co-laborer Brian Snider of Huntsville, Alabama. To our knowledge, this is the largest directory of fundamental Baptist churches on the Internet, and it is aggressively maintained, but only AS PEOPLE SEND US INFORMATION AND UPDATES. Since it is impossible for us to visit most of the churches listed at the directory, we are largely dependent upon the feedback of friends. We have heard from many people who have found good churches, as well as from many pastors who have gained members. As I travel on preaching trips, I often meet people who use the directory. OUR NEW QUESTIONNAIRE Some people assume that we only list churches with which we are personally familiar, but that is not the case. We are dependent upon submissions from friends in the Lord. The churches that have a double asterisk (**) are the only churches on the directory that we personally recommend and have personal knowledge of. The churches with a single asterisk (*) are churches that have filled out our Questionnaire and that appear to be likeminded with our stand. We devised the Questionnaire after Brother Snider took over the directory, and we now require all churches to fill it out before we give the single asterisk (*). Last year we went through the directory and removed all asterisk from churches that have not filled out the Questionnaire.
